Doc: minor improvements for plpgsql "Transaction Management" section.
Point out that savepoint commands cannot be issued in PL/pgSQL, and suggest that exception blocks can usually be used instead. Add a caveat to the discussion of cursor loops vs. transactions, pointing out that any locks taken by the cursor query will be lost at COMMIT. This is implicit in what's already said, but the existing text leaves the distinct impression that the auto-hold behavior is transparent, which it's not really. Per a couple of recent complaints (one unsigned, and one in bug #18531 from Dzmitry Jachnik). Back-patch to v17, just so this makes it into current docs in less than a year-and-a-half.
